The Industrial Inverter CO2 MIG Welding Machine represents a significant advancement in welding technology, integrating high-frequency IGBT inverter systems with practical operational features. Operating at frequencies up to 20KHZ, this machine delivers exceptionally fast reaction times and precise arc control that surpasses conventional welding equipment. The digital display interface allows operators to accurately set current and voltage parameters before initiating welding operations, while the PWM control method ensures consistent output quality and stable performance across diverse applications. Engineered for industrial environments, the machine features robust construction with IP21 protection and F-class insulation, ensuring durability and operator safety in demanding workshop conditions.

Key Features:
- IGBT inverter technology operating at 20KHZ frequency ensures rapid response and stable arc performance
- Digital display interface enables precise current and voltage parameter adjustment before welding
- Automatic current adjustment mechanism activates when wire extension changes up to 30mm
- Strong capability against power fluctuations with 310V-450V operating voltage range
- Multiple model configurations available with different capacity options to suit various applications
